Uganda Female underweight children between 1988 and 2022
Period | Value | Change |
---|---|---|
2022 | 8.2% | +2.2% |
2020 | 6% | 0% |
2018 | 6% | -3.4% |
2016 | 9.4% | +0.7% |
2015 | 8.7% | -2.1% |
2014 | 10.8% | -0.2% |
2012 | 11% | -2% |
2011 | 13% | -2.1% |
2009 | 15.1% | +0.6% |
2006 | 14.5% | -2.6% |
2000 | 17.1% | -2.3% |
1995 | 19.4% | +0.3% |
1988 | 19.1% |
